Basic Info
Headquarter
Ontario, Canada
1429481 Ontario is a company that provides Telecommunications, Cloud computing, Cloud database and more. 1429481 Ontario is headquartered in Canada Ontario. 1429481 Ontario was founded in 1995.
Related Topics
TelecommunicationsCloud computingCloud databaseEnterprise software